Proven Winners Gatsby Glow Oakleaf Hydrangea
Best low-maintenance native shrub for small gardens and container planting.
This dwarf shrub delivers the dramatic, color-shifting blooms of a classic oakleaf hydrangea without the sprawling footprint. It is a low-maintenance native that trades massive size for a tidy, container-friendly habit, ensuring you get year-round visual interest even in the tightest garden corners.

Performance breakdown
Seasonal Versatility
Provides year-round visual interest from summer blooms to autumn foliage.
Pollinator Impact
Hollow stems and nectar-rich flowers actively support local bee populations.
Container Adaptability
Compact dwarf habit makes it perfect for patio pots and planters.
Maintenance Ease
A resilient native variety that requires minimal intervention once established.
Environmental Tolerance
Handles heat and salt air well, though requires consistent moisture.
Wildlife Resistance
Lacks natural deer resistance, requiring protection in high-pressure garden areas.
Key Specs
Botanical Name
Hydrangea quercifolia
Growth Habit
Shrub
Mature Height
4 Feet
Mature Width
4 Feet
Sun Exposure
Full Sun, Partial Shade
USDA Hardiness Zones
Zone 5, Zone 6, Zone 7, Zone 8, Zone 9
Plant Life Cycle
Perennial, Shrub
Water Requirement
Moderate
Soil Type Preference
Loamy, Clay, Well-drained
Bloom Season
Summer
